A Review of Structure, Properties, and Chemical Synthesis of Magnetite Nanoparticles [PDF]
Extensive studies were devoted to iron oxide nanoparticles (IONPs), in recent years. Iron oxides are chemical compounds that have various polymorphic forms, including maghemite (γ-Fe2O3), magnetite (Fe3O4), and Hematite (α-Fe2O3).
